Coupling rotating disk electrodes and surface-enhanced Raman spectroscopy for in situ electrochemistry studies

In this work, rotating disk electrodes (RDEs) and surface-enhanced Raman spectroscopy (SERS) have been integrated and used to reveal the mechanism of electrochemical reduction of 4-nitrothiophenol.
